Add support to readelf for reading NetBSD ELF core notes.
binutils * binutils.c (process_netbsd_elf_note): New function. (process_note): Call the new function for NetBSD core notes. include * common.h (NT_NETBSD_MARCH): Define.

+static int
+process_netbsd_elf_note (Elf_Internal_Note * pnote)
+{
+ unsigned int version;
+
+ switch (pnote->type)
+ {
+ case NT_NETBSD_IDENT:
+ version = byte_get ((unsigned char *) pnote->descdata, sizeof (version));
+ if ((version / 10000) % 100)
+ printf (" NetBSD\t\t0x%08lx\tIDENT %u (%u.%u%s%c)\n", pnote->descsz,
+ version, version / 100000000, (version / 1000000) % 100,
+ (version / 10000) % 100 > 26 ? "Z" : "",
+ 'A' + (version / 10000) % 26);
+ else
+ printf (" NetBSD\t\t0x%08lx\tIDENT %u (%u.%u.%u)\n", pnote->descsz,
+ version, version / 100000000, (version / 1000000) % 100,
+ (version / 100) % 100);
+ return 1;
+
+ case NT_NETBSD_MARCH:
+ printf (" NetBSD\t0x%08lx\tMARCH <%s>\n", pnote->descsz,
+ pnote->descdata);
+ return 1;
+
+ default:
+ break;
+ }
+
+ printf (" NetBSD\t0x%08lx\tUnknown note type: (0x%08lx)\n", pnote->descsz,
+ pnote->type);
+ return 1;
+}
